To signal alane change, just raise or lower the lever until the arrowstarts to flash. Holdit there until you complete yourlane change. The lever will return by itself when you release it. Headlamp High/Low Beam Changer First, you must have headlamps on.For high beams, the push the turn signal lever toward the instrument panel. When the high beams are on, a light onthe instrument panel also willbe on. It will go off when you switch to low beam. As you signal a turn a lane change, if the arrows or don't flash but just stay on, a signal bulb may burned be out and other drivers won't see your turn signal. If a bulb is burned out, replace it to help avoid an accident. If the arrows don't on at all when you go signal aturn, check the fuse (see "Fuses and Circuit Breakers" in the Index) andfor burned-out bulbs. Lamps On Reminder If you turn the ignition off, remove the key, open the door and leave lamps on, a tone will remind you the to turn off your lamps. To switch back to low beams, pull the lever toward you Flash-to-Pass With the lever in low-beam position, pull the lever the toward you to momentarily switch to high beam (to signal that you are going to pass). When you release th lever, the headlamps will return to low-beam operation. 2-31
